4 cly twin turbo 2.1L VS 6 cly 3.0 ? Does anyone have experience with either one? Milage, drivable, sometime towing. What about highway cruising? I looking at the smaller Mercedes sprinter 150 van.

Most recent buyers over on the Sprinter Forum seem to prefer the 2.1L inline 4 with its smooth 7 speed auto transmission. Our Sprinter mechanic thinks it's the best Sprinter powertrain yet. Probably 22-25 mpg normal driving, less when towing.

The 3.0L V6 is the only engine option available with 4 wheel drive, and it might be preferable for some heavy and continuous towing applications. Mileage will be about 3 mpg less than the I4, perhaps 5-6 less with both V6 and 4x4 options.

We have a 2015 2.1 7 speed and absolutely are amazed with it. Not 4wd but it has seen some really steep roads. Average 23-24 MPG in all conditions with a box on top. Low roof, penthouse top probably helps over the higher roof. The cross wind assist is amazing. We had an 05 that was a solid work horse but this engine is incredible. On the highway it drives like a car, easy to see everything and stable, smooth, easy to drive. You will be really happy with this engine.
